Drinking Water Filtration in Sarasota, FL
Drinking water filtration services involve installing systems designed to improve the quality and safety of tap water for residential properties. These services typically cover a range of projects, including the installation of point-of-use filters, whole-house filtration systems, and upgrades to existing setups to remove common contaminants such as chlorine, sediment, heavy metals, and other impurities. Property owners often seek these services to ensure their drinking water is clean, tastes better, and meets health standards, especially in areas where water quality concerns are prevalent.
Before requesting drinking water filtration services, homeowners should consider factors such as the source of their water, specific contaminants they want to address, and the type of filtration system best suited to their household needs. Understanding the flow rate, maintenance requirements, and overall system compatibility with existing plumbing can help in selecting an effective solution. Clarifying these details can ensure the chosen filtration system provides reliable, safe drinking water tailored to the household's requirements.

Common Drinking Water Filtration Jobs
Point-of-Use Filtration - installed at a faucet to provide clean drinking water directly from the tap.
Whole-House Filtration - filters water at the main supply to improve water quality throughout the property.
Reverse Osmosis Systems - remove impurities and contaminants for highly purified drinking water.
Sediment Filtration - eliminates dirt, rust, and particles to extend the lifespan of plumbing fixtures.
Carbon Filtration - reduces chlorine, odors, and chemical tastes for better-tasting water.
UV Water Purification - uses ultraviolet light to disinfect water and eliminate bacteria and viruses.
Drinking Water Filtration Questions
What types of contaminants can a drinking water filtration system remove? Filtration systems can reduce common contaminants such as chlorine, sediment, lead, and certain bacteria, improving water quality for household use.
How often should a drinking water filter be replaced? Filter replacement frequency varies based on the system type and water usage, typically ranging from every few months to annually.
Can a filtration system improve the taste and odor of water? Yes, many filtration options effectively remove substances that cause unpleasant taste and odor, resulting in clearer, better-tasting water.
What is the best type of filtration system for a residential property? The ideal system depends on water quality and household needs, with options including activated carbon filters, reverse osmosis units, and UV purifiers.
